Here is another gorgeous and historic Peruvian rhodochrosite cluster of cherry-red, superbly-displayed, completely terminated crystals, also from the Jack Halpern collection (a suite of such historic specimens is available in this update). There are four larger, colorful crystals to one-inch accompanied by a few smaller ones, all having great color, luster and good translucency. It is an elongated cluster composed of complex "shield style" rhombohedrons, some showing low-profile, geometric growth hillocks on some faces. The crystals are largely translucent with some nearly transparent areas around their edges, especially on the largest crystal. It is a very attractive miniature from finds at Uchucchacua in the early 1990s. Purchased by Jack Halpern from Ken Roberts when it came out, and in the collection for nearly 30 years since, this is a very rare and old style to come to market now.
